TECHNOLOGY:

 

DWR: This coating allows water to form beads and run off the shell fabric instead of being absorbed. The water-repellent outer fabric increases insulation and prevents it from being saturated by liquids, preventing any feeling of dampness.

 

COMPOSITION:

Ripstop: This synthetic fabric, often made from nylon or polyester, uses a special reinforcing technique that makes it tear and abrasion-resistant. During the weaving process, reinforcement threads are interwoven at regular intervals into the hatched pattern. These intervals are generally 5 to 8 millimetres. Ripstop fabric is thin and lightweight with thicker threads interwoven into thinner cloth for a 3-dimensional structure.

Technowarm® Loft: The TechnoWarm® Loft padding is a blend of naturally comfortable fibres. The blend of synthetic fibres offer a perfect combination of compression, weight and heat.

 

CERTIFICATION:

 

PFC Free: PFCs belong to a group of chemical compounds that are used in a number of outdoor products for waterproofing the outer material. Their use has received a lot of criticism, as they are considered non-biodegradable. They build up in the body and are suspected to be harmful to health.

PFC-free products are environmentally friendly.

OEKO-TEX® Certification: The innovative fibres used are certified by Oeko-Tex®, an internationally recognised control body. This label certifies that the fibres do not contain chemical elements that are harmful to the skin and the individual.

Bluesign® Standard: Environmental program to eliminate substances that are potentially hazardous to human health or the environment from the textile supply chain. A Bluesign® approved fabric ensures that:

  • The fabric itself is free of harmful chemicals
  • Unsafe emissions in water, ground and air are reduced
  • The use of energy resources is controlled and reduced to a minimum
  • The working conditions are healthy and safe

Low Impact™: Low Impact™ is based on 2 criteria that are essential to eco-design: the use of materials with a low environmental impact (at least 40% of the weight of the product is made from low impact materials such as Ecoya, Sorona®, tencel, hemp, RDS feathers), or certified materials (at least 80% of the product weight must be certified Bluesign®, Oeko-Tex®).

 

Lafuma has become a member of 1% for the Planet for its equipment range and joins this international collective of companies, associations and individuals working together for a healthy planet! This is a logical step for Lafuma, the result of over 30 years of commitment.

Since 1993, Lafuma has collaborated with an entire ecosystem of communities: WWF, France Nature Environnement, Naturevolution, Surfrider, Mountain Riders, Mountain Wilderness, Act for the Outdoors, etc. Lafuma took on their share of responsibility as a brand very early on, with belief in their significant power to act. 1% for the Planet and Lafuma share common values and are both pioneers.

The 1% for the Planet endowment fund connects patrons and companies with associations that have projects and monitors the respect of the commitment by the members. Member companies undertake to donate 1% of their annual turnover (total or of a range) to approved associations.
